引言
在去中心化金融生态日趋复杂的今天,TPWallet 作为一个跨链、轻量化的数字钱包,承载着用户资产的入口任务。本教程以“安全数据加密、合约性能、专业观察预测、新兴技术支付、链上治理、备份恢复”六大维度,系统性地拆解 TPWallet 的设计要点、实现实践与未来趋势,帮助开发者、企业与普通用户构建更稳健的使用与运维体系。
一、系统框架概览
TPWallet 的核心目标是在保持用户体验的前提下,提供可审核、可扩展、可回退的钱包能力。核心组件包括:本地密钥管理模块、加密与隐私保护层、跨链交互网关、合约交互优化层、链上治理接口、以及备份与恢复机制。本节概览性描述可帮助读者快速定位到后续章节的落地要点。
二、安全数据加密
1) 本地密钥与数据分离
- 用户私钥、助记词及相关派生密钥在设备端存储,但以加密形式保存,不在云端等待明文暴露。
- 使用操作系统提供的安全存储能力(如 iOS 的 Keychain、Android 的 TEE/Keystore)对关键材料进行绑定级保护。
2) 对称与非对称加密的分层设计
- 账户级别的对称密钥用作本地缓存数据的加密(AES-256)。
- 私钥采用非对称加密方案进行保护或以椭圆曲线密钥对形式存储,只有在需要签名时才解密并参与签署。
3) 助记词和密钥的保护策略
- 助记词以离线方式离散化存储,支持分片(Shamir 的秘密分享)以提升容错性与灾难恢复能力。
- 引入密码派生函数(如 Argon2、PBKDF2)对密钥进行二次保护,防止暴力破解。
4) 传输层安全与最小权限
- 全链路 TLS 1.3,强制证书绑定(证书固定/证书指纹),防止中间人攻击。
- 仅在必要时请求授权、最小化权限范围,遵循“需要时才授权”的原则。
5) 代码层面的防护与审计
- 内部审计覆盖关键签名路径、密钥派生、跨链调用、合约调用的安全漏洞。
- 引入静态分析、符号执行、模糊测试等多层次测试,结合第三方安全评估。
6) 备份与灾难恢复的安全性
- 密钥分片备份、离线存储、跨设备的不可逆恢复路径,防止单点故障导致资产丢失。
- 提供“只读视图模式”以帮助用户在不暴露私钥的前提下进行账户监控。
三、合约性能
1) 友好、可预测的接口设计
- 尽可能使用只读调用(view/pure)获取链上信息,减少不必要的交易成本。
- 将高频数据缓存至本地或中间层,降低对链上查询的依赖。
2) Gas 优化与成本模型
- 尽量批量化处理交易,利用多签或代理合约降低多次签名与重复调用带来的成本。
- 针对常用场景(授权、转账、跨链桥接)设计最小化的交易结构,减少 gas 噪性。
3) 安全性与可维护性平衡
- 使用代理合约与可升级模式时,确保升级过程可审计、可撤回,且对用户资产无风险暴露。
- 对关键合约交互进行审计追踪,建立变更日志与回滚策略。
4) 跨链交互的性能考量
- 引入异步签名与事件通知机制,减少等待时间。
- 优化跨链调用失败的回退策略,确保在网络拥堵时仍具备可用性。
5) 审计与监控
- 与稳定的监控体系集成,实时监控交易状态、异常模式、潜在攻击路径。
- 将性能指标与成本指标绑定,形成持续改进闭环。
四、专业观察预测
1) 市场与用户行为趋势
- 用户将越来越关注私钥控制权与隐私保护,去中心化钱包的对隐私友好性成为核心卖点。
- 跨链协作与互操作性提升,将带来更多跨链钱包能力及支付场景。
2) 技术演进趋势
- 零知识证明(ZK)与分布式密钥的新组合将提升隐私与安全性,同时降低链上数据暴露。
- 可验证的延迟执行与离线签名将成为高安全场景下的常态。
3) 监管与治理趋势
- 监管机构对去中心化治理与资金池的合规要求将逐步落地,钱包需要提供透明、可审计的治理轨迹。
4) 生态系统演进
- 新型支付通道、闪电网络式微支付、以及稳定币的广泛集成将推动日常交易的普及化。
5) 安全演化
- 零信任架构与多方密钥分布将成为主流防线,硬件信任根与软件多重防护并行。
五、新兴技术支付
1) 支付通道与微支付
- 支付通道能够实现“双向结算、低延迟、低成本”的微支付场景,适合内容付费、游戏内消费等。
2) 跨链支付网络
- 通过跨链网关实现跨链资产支付与清算,提升用户跨链体验的一致性与可预测性。
3) 稳定币与抵押/抵换机制
- 与稳定币的深度集成降低波动风险,结合瞬时清算机制提升支付效率。
4) 近场支付与隐私保护

- 二维码、近场通讯(NFC)等技术与隐私保护结合,提供更便捷的线下支付方案。
5) 混合支付场景
- 将隐私计算与支付结合,提供分层的支付体验,在公开透明与隐私保护之间取得平衡。
六、链上治理
1) 治理设计原则
- 去中心化治理应具备清晰的提案、投票、执行三个阶段,具备透明的权责分离。
- 提案门槛、投票权重、时间窗等机制需经社区充分讨论并可证伪化。
2) 提案与投票流程
- 提案草案需可追溯的提交记录,所有投票结果与执行记录在链上可查询。
- 设定风险缓释期与自动化执行条件,避免单点异常导致治理失灵。
3) 资金与治理的分离
- 将治理预算与日常运营资金分离,确保治理行为不会直接影响核心资产的安全性。
4) 社区参与与教育
- 提供清晰简明的治理文档、演示视频和示例案例,降低参与门槛,提升社区参与度。
七、备份与恢复
1) 密钥备份与分布式存储
- 提供多地点离线备份、硬件钱包备份、云端加密备份等组合方案,避免单点故障。
2) 多重授权与分片备份
- 使用 Shamir 秘密分享等技术实现密钥的多人分担与恢复能力,降低个人设备丢失造成的风险。
3) 恢复流程与演练
- 设定清晰的恢复流程、所需材料清单、角色分配,以及定期演练的日程,以确保紧急情况下的快速恢复。

4) 版本控制与变更记录
- 版本化备份与变更记录,确保恢复后的一致性、可追溯性,避免数据篡改。
5) 法规与合规
- 在跨地域场景中遵守当地数据保护法规,确保备份与恢复过程的合规性。
八、落地实践与风险提示
- 实施分层安全策略:本地设备层、应用层、网络层、合约层各自设定独立的安全措施与监控。
- 强化用户教育:密钥保护、重要操作的双签或多签验证、警惕钓鱼攻击等。
- 定期独立安全审计与渗透测试,形成持续改进的安全闭环。
- 设定应急预案与演练计划,确保在异常情况下的快速响应。
结论
TPWallet 的成功落地不仅在于技术实现的健壮,更在于对安全、性能、治理、支付新技术以及备份恢复等多维度的综合把控。本教程从六大维度出发,提供了一系列可落地的设计原则与实践路径。随着区块链生态的不断发展,掌握这些核心要素将帮助用户与开发者共同推动去中心化钱包的长期可持续性与用户信任的提升。
评论
NovaKitty
TPWallet 的安全设计很实用,尤其是密钥分片和离线备份的思路值得借鉴。
风中采薇
合约性能分析全面,关注点明确,尤其是跨链调用的成本控制很实际。
CryptoNova
链上治理部分写得很到位,提案到执行的流程清晰,社区参与感强。
Luna星
新兴支付部分很有前瞻性,跨链支付的场景化应用让我看到了很多可能。
ChenWei
备份恢复策略实用,但希望增加一个可落地的演练模板和时间表。